A Socially Conscious Alpha
Selfless heir to the Rutledge family fortune, Thaddeus Rutledge leads a life of privilege he'd rather not fall back on. After returning home to Aurora from military deployment, he follows his heart and opens a community soup kitchen to serve the less fortunate. But no matter how much he gives, something's missing. All Thaddeus wants is someone who can love him for who he is, not what he can do for them.
A Runaway Omega
Seth Cooper is locked in a gilded cage. Abandoned as a baby and taken in by The White Lotus brothel, he's learned that as an omega, he has no value other than in service to the alpha clientele. Still, Seth can't help but wonder if somewhere out there, there's an alpha who could treat him right.
A Rescue Of Two Hearts
When a medical emergency gives Seth the out he so desperately wants, it's up to Thaddeus to decide his fate: either give Seth up to the men hunting him down, or shelter him and risk it all for love.
Love Me is a 33,000 word stand-alone novella set in an alpha/beta/omega universe. It contains alpha/omega knotting, loving and depending on each other to be exactly what the other needs.

Piper Scott debuted as a trio of authors looking to write together for fun. Their collaboration led to three novella-length books (Love Me, Save Me, and Keep Me,) before life sent them in different directions, leaving just one author with an omegaverse plot bunny that wouldn’t leave her alone. Obey was born several months later… but the plot bunny never left—it multiplied. Left to her own devices, Piper Scott writes scorching but heartfelt contemporary omegaverse romance about men you can’t help but fall in love with. Also writes under the pen name Emma Alcott.
